Hospital Attack: Man Bites Off Patient's Ear

A violent incident unfolded at Bolton Hospital's accident and emergency department on Friday afternoon when a 22-year-old man launched an assault on several patients. The unprovoked attacks left one man with severe ear injuries, part of which was bitten off, and another frail patient was punched to the ground. Two additional individuals sustained minor injuries.

Eyewitnesses described scenes of horror and panic as the man became irate and began attacking others. A bystander and a nurse intervened to restrain the suspect before security and police arrived. The arrested man has been taken into custody on suspicion of assault and public order offenses, and is being detained under Section 136 of the Mental Health Act.

Greater Manchester Police are conducting a thorough investigation into the circumstances surrounding the assaults. The incident has understandably caused distress among patients, staff, and the local community, highlighting concerns about safety within healthcare environments. Authorities are appealing for any witnesses with further information to come forward.
